Handover — Vexler partner SFTP drop

Ownership moves to you today. Drop runs hourly from Vexler's end into the intake bucket via the relay host. Watch for zero-byte files; their exporter flakes on Mondays. Creds live in the ops vault, path noted in the runbook. Vault auto-seals after 48h idle. Support escalations go to the on-call rotation, not me. If the vault is sealed when you need it, unseal with the recovery passphrase below.

recovery phrase for tadug-fafof: zorwyn-kasion

# Guest Wi-Fi Desk — Reception

The guest Wi-Fi desk sits at the north end of reception in Halloran House. Team assistants issue day passes to visitors from the terminal there. Visitors must be signed in first; no pass without a host name. Printed vouchers expire at midnight. The terminal locks after five minutes idle. Report faults to the facilities desk. Unlock the terminal drawer with the code below.

door code, yagap-bahof: bdg-O-05

Thanks for submitting this reconciliation plugin for the Ledgerline inventory job. A few careful notes for external authors: your hook runs inside the nightly sweep, so any blocking call you make delays every downstream warehouse diff. Please batch your SKU lookups rather than issuing one query per record, and honor the retry budget we expose — exceeding it will get your plugin quarantined automatically. Also make sure your idempotency keys survive restarts. All of these behaviors are controlled by the constants listed below.

tuning table, yajog-yahof:
BUDGETS = {
    "lamvan": 303,
    "wenox": 460,
    "fenvan": 525,
}

# Headcount Plan — Next Fiscal Year

**Restricted — Managers Only**

Prepared for the board. Net headcount grows 4%, concentrated in the Farrow engineering group and field service. Corporate functions stay flat; attrition backfills only. The Lindqvist site consolidation removes twelve roles, offset by redeployment. Payroll impact is within the approved envelope. A confidential planning note is attached beneath this summary.

internal memo for hahaf-kahof: Only 39 of the 428 pilot accounts renewed Sorion, so a churn review is set for April 12. Praokix Freight is in early talks to buy Queniusox Group for about $145.8 million.